Requirement Details
Tendering Procedure: Open Tendering
Description of Work:
The Information Management and Information Technology (IMIT) Branch of INFC requires the services of IT Asset Management personnel to work with INFC personnel to manage and track IT inventory and to assist in distributing/shipping IT equipment to personnel across Canada. They will be required to wipe content on returned computers and image new computers. The resources will also assist during the revamp of the onsite workspace, evergreening of computers and future upcoming projects.
Some of the work is currently being performed by Dynamic Personnel through a Temporary Help Services (THS) Call-Up Against a Standing Offer; however, this is an ongoing requirement which INFC wishes to procure for a longer time period.
